noun
- the action of liquid flowing out forcefully
- lengthy, pompous speech
Usage: informal
verb
- present participle of spout; flowing or shooting out forcefully
- speaking at length in a pompous or tedious manner
Usage: informal
Examples
- Water was spouting from the broken pipe.
- The whale was spouting in the distance.
- He kept spouting nonsense about conspiracy theories.
- She was spouting off about politics again.
- The spouting from the fountain was impressive.
- I’m tired of his constant spouting about work.
- Oil came spouting out of the ground.
